Ritu Dhawan-Foster is a proven executive board director with a clear focus on improving shareholder value, understanding the power of people to deliver growth and improve profit through modern leadership. …
Ritu Dhawan-Foster is a proven executive board director with a clear focus on improving shareholder value, understanding the power of people to deliver growth and improve profit through modern leadership. A change leader with in depth commercial and strategic experience within consumer facing global brands and sectors, Ritu designs and implements the people plans aligned to the business plan and strategic direction of the organisation. She is currently Interim HR Director UK&I at L’Occitane Group. Prior to this, she was Interim Director of People & Transformation at Vue International from August 2022 – May 2023, where she led their business transformation and value creation in order to prepare the business for a transaction. She was previously Chief People Officer at Monsoon Accessorize for eight years, and Head of Human Resources at Fortnum & Mason for three years.

Una O’Reilly has worked extensively in human resources, organisational development and employee engagement, with a track record of creating award-winning people practices that promote inclusivity, attract top talent, improve …
Una O’Reilly has worked extensively in human resources, organisational development and employee engagement, with a track record of creating award-winning people practices that promote inclusivity, attract top talent, improve retention and increase engagement leading to stronger commercial business results. Her skills in steering organisations through periods of significant growth and transformation really came to fruition when working as the European Human Resource Director Westfield, where she oversaw the People Leadership aspects of the merger of Westfield with Unibail-Rodamco and helped develop and deliver values and led strategies to enhance employee engagement, wellbeing, and advance diversity and inclusion. This included, among many other things, reviewing all People practices and maternity and paternity policies, that earned URW 9 Best Practice Awards and got Top Employer recognition. In addition, the diversity and inclusion strategy resulted in 40% of senior management roles being held by women, and a community strategy that led to 80% of employees taking part in volunteering which led to them taking home the HR Excellence Award for Best CSR Strategy.

Jennie Williams is the founder and CEO of Enhance The UK – a non-profit organisation specialising in disability awareness and inclusion, run by disabled people, for disabled people. Jennie is …
Jennie Williams is the founder and CEO of Enhance The UK – a non-profit organisation specialising in disability awareness and inclusion, run by disabled people, for disabled people. Jennie is neurodivergent, a hearing aid user, and lives with a chronic pain condition; she brings this lived experience of disability and over a decade’s worth of experience in ethical leadership and disability awareness training to her role. Enhance The UK also runs Undressing Disability – a trailblazing initiative raising standards in sexual health and wellbeing for disabled people. Jennie is a resident expert at Undressing Disability’s Love Lounge service, which provides free, confidential support on all things sex, dating and relationships for disabled people.
